Analysis
In 2015, pisa: female 15-year-olds by mathematics proficiency level (%). level in Tunisia stood at 1.7%.
That represents a change of down 22.6% on the previous year and down 5.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pisa: female 15-year-olds by mathematics proficiency level (%). level in Tunisia peaked at 2.2% in 2012 and was at its lowest, 0.9%, in 2009.
That places Tunisia 52nd out of 53 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the bottom quarter.

About this data
Percentage of 15-year-old female students scoring higher than 545 but lower than or equal to 607 on the PISA mathematics scale. At Level 4, students can work effectively with explicit models for complex concrete situations that may involve constraints or call for making assumptions. They can select and integrate different representations, including symbolic, linking them directly to aspects of real-world situations. Students at this level can utilize their limited range of skills and can reason with some insight, in straightforward contexts. They can construct and communicate explanations and arguments based on their interpretations, arguments, and actions. Data reflects country performance in the stated year according to PISA reports, but may not be comparable across years or countries.
